Supported Browsers and Platforms
Browsers and Connected TV
The CONNECT Player SDK for Browsers and Connected TV works across all browsers where EME/MSE is supported.
Browser | Operating system | Supported | Not supported |
|---|---|---|---|
Microsoft Edge | Windows | DASH (EME/MSE) | HLS |
Google Chrome | Windows/Mac | DASH (EME/MSE). |
|
Mozilla Firefox | Windows/Mac | DASH (EME/MSE) | HLS |
Apple Safari | Mac | HLS | DASH |
LG TV | webOS | DASH (EME/MSE) | HLS |
Samsung TV | Tizen | DASH (EME/MSE) | HLS |

Video and audio codecs
The table below shows the video and audio decoders supported by CONNECT Player on each platform.
Android SDK 5 | Apple SDK 5 for FPS | Browsers and Connected TV SDK 5 | |
|---|---|---|---|
Video codec | H.264 | H.264 | H.264 |
Audio codec | AAC-LC | AAC-LC | AAC-LC |
Audio/Video container | ISOBMFF/F-MP4 | ISOBMFF/F-MP4 (CMAF) | MPEG2-TS |
Encryption | CENC | AES-128 CBC | CENC |
